It is currently only supported by certain web sites and apps, including the Safari app. Aug 21, 2016 · If you know your old password, use that password to update your existing login keychain: Open the Keychain Access app, which is in the the Utilities folder of your Applications folder. From the Edit menu, choose “Change Password for Keychain 'login.'”. Enter the old password of your user account in the Current Password field. How to fix Can't log in to Mac after macOS Big sur update, Big sure does not accept user account, macOS Big Sur cannot login, big sur stuck ...In the Terminal app on your Mac, type your administrator account password at the prompt, then press Return. WARNING: To keep your password secure, the characters in your password aren’t displayed as you type. Even though no characters appear as you type and the cursor doesn’t move, enter your password, then press Return. See also Enter ...Try creating a new user account on your MacBook Pro. Dec 29, 2022 · macOS. Click on the Apple menu and go to System Preferences. Then click on Network and hit the Advanced button. Under Preferred networks , click on the Wi-Fi network you want to remove and hit the delete option (the minus sign). Click on Remove and save the changes.
